    Uncharted 3: Drake's Deception

    Drake heads to the desert as Sony/Naughty Dog unveils new Uncharted news ahead of this weekend's VGA Awards!





    Sony has unveiled a new Uncharted ahead of its big reveal at this weekend's VGA Awards, with first details confirming that Uncharted 3: Drake's Deception takes the wise-cracking hero to the deserts of the Arabian Peninsula.

            First Live Demo of Uncharted 3 Hits TVs Nationwide Next Week

            Late Night with Jimmy Fallon will show off the first live demo of hotly-anticipated Playstation 3 exclusive Uncharted 3: Drake's Deception next Monday, Dec. 13.

            Show producer Gavin Purcell Tweets that developers Naughty Dog will be on hand to demonstrate the game to show host and gamer Fallon.

                        PlayStation Blog

                        UNCHARTED 3: Drake’s Deception continues to evolve the all of the core principles we laid out for the UNCHARTED franchise, most important of which is creating an unmatched and extremely compelling interactive cinematic experience. In addition to having a compelling story and authentic characters that all of our fans can relate to as key facets to creating this type of experience, we push ourselves and the capability of the PlayStation hardware through constantly refined gameplay mechanics and technology innovation. Our dedication to creating the best interactive cinematic experience can be seen in our last two games – UNCHARTED: Drake’s Fortune and UNCHARTED 2: Among Thieves. We’re especially honored and humbled that both titles have been so successful, selling nearly 8 million units combined and earning more industry awards and accolades than we can keep track of. We’ve set the bar very high for us to outdo the past successes of our previous UNCHARTED games. We’re looking forward to taking on this challenge to top ourselves and create a truly unforgettable interactive cinematic experience that everyone can enjoy.

                        So, if you’re wondering what UNCHARTED 3: Drake’s Deception has in store for you, we wanted to share some early details.

                        UNCHARTED 3: Drake’s Deception features the return of famed fortune hunter Nathan Drake and follows him through a gripping, action-packed storyline that will take you all over the world. In his search for the fabled “Atlantis of the Sands,” Nathan Drake and longtime friend and mentor Victor Sullivan set off on a daring trek into the heart of the Arabian Desert. But when terrible secrets of this lost city are uncovered, their journey becomes a desperate bid for survival that will force Drake to confront his deepest fears.

                        Throughout UNCHARTED 3, you’ll be taken to spectacular new locations around the globe that will showcase all of the work we’ve taken on to take acclaimed physics, particle and visual effects to a new level.

                        Competitive and co-op multiplayer will return as a key ingredient to the UNCHARTED 3 package, where all of the new features we have planned will combine with our signature single-player cinematic gameplay to create a unique action-adventure multiplayer experience that can only be found in the UNCHARTED universe.

                        Oh, and there’s one more thing – UNCHARTED 3: Drake’s Deception fully supports high-resolution Stereoscopic 3D.

                        We’re looking forward to exploring it all with you in the months to come.
